Output 635282631e4f3256c99854d4b89cd2e06a1bf2be80a5225ee70f459a841e0819:0

value
521308868
script pubkey
OP_0 OP_PUSHBYTES_20 17cda677afe8b0a394a01d1f87ab6cf70803e8c9
address
bc1qzlx6vaa0azc2899qr50c02mv7uyq86xfkdgn02
transaction
635282631e4f3256c99854d4b89cd2e06a1bf2be80a5225ee70f459a841e0819